I made the switch in Oct from a MTB to a road bike, and I am really glad I did. The biggest advantage was the different gearing allows me to continue pedaling at higher speeds than I could before. With the MTB, my top speeds were typically around 22mph and I was spinning out in the top gear. With the road bike, I would hit 25mph in the same areas and still be able to keep my cadence at a reasonable level. The road bike has helped me to work on having a better cadence in general.
Along with this, I enjoy going faster, and this also allows me to go farther. Most of my exercise time is time constrained, so the faster I go, the farther I can go. I still use the MTB with the kids, but I much prefer riding the road bike.
